i dunno if it helps, but i got a complete catback exhaust from a 00 EX on my 93 EX. When comparing the lengths of the b-pipe, they were exactly the same (bends, hangers, etc...). I think the only difference is in the muffler. It sits like 1 1/2 - 2" out past the bumper. Nothing major, but enough for me to have it shortened by a friend with a welder

hope it helps, shouldn't be too much different then a hatch
